What are STEM and STEAM learning toys?
STEM (Science, Technology, Engineering, and Math) and STEAM (adds Art) learning toys are designed to spark curiosity and encourage hands-on exploration. These tools help students connect real-world concepts to classroom learning through play. Examples include math manipulatives, science lab kits, building sets, and beginner coding toysāall designed to build foundational skills while keeping kids engaged.
Why are STEM/STEAM toys important in the classrooms?
STEM and STEAM toys promote critical thinking, creativity, and collaboration. These learning tools go beyond memorizationāhelping students build problem-solving skills, develop perseverance, and learn how to work as a team. Whether itās figuring out how to balance a structure or writing basic code, these toys prepare students to think, test, and try again.
What are math manipulatives and what are the benefits?
Math manipulatives are physical learning toolsālike counters, dice, base ten blocks, or geometric shapesāthat help students visualize math concepts. Theyāre especially useful for younger learners and kinesthetic learners. Manipulative play supports motor skills, sequencing, pattern recognition, and problem-solving. Students also build confidence by experimenting and finding solutions through hands-on discovery.
